WhatsApp Business API Providers: Top 6 BSPs Compared 2026

Compare the top 6 WhatsApp Business API providers (BSPs): Twilio, MessageBird, Gupshup, 360dialog, Infobip, Kanal. Pricing, features, and best fit for Shopify.
Table of contents (20)
What Is a WhatsApp Business API Provider?
A WhatsApp Business API provider (BSP) is a Meta-authorized partner that gives businesses access to the WhatsApp Business Platform. While the free WhatsApp Business App works for small businesses handling a few dozen conversations, the API is essential when you need automation, multiple agents, and integration with your tech stack. If you're new to the platform, start with our complete WhatsApp Business API guide before picking a provider.
The right provider can make or break your WhatsApp marketing strategy. Choose poorly, and you'll spend months dealing with technical issues instead of growing revenue.
How We Evaluated Providers
We compared providers across five key criteria:
- Ease of setup: how fast can you go from sign-up to sending your first message?
- E-commerce features: abandoned cart recovery, order notifications, product catalogs
- Pricing transparency: monthly fees, per-message costs, hidden charges
- Integration ecosystem: Shopify, Klaviyo, Gorgias, and other tools
- Support quality: response time, documentation, onboarding help
Provider Comparison
1. Kanal

Best for: Shopify and e-commerce brands
Kanal is purpose-built for e-commerce, with a native Shopify integration that takes minutes to set up. Unlike generic messaging platforms, every feature is designed around the e-commerce customer journey.
- Setup time: Under 10 minutes with Shopify
- Key features: Abandoned cart recovery, AI chatbot, broadcast campaigns, order notifications
- Pricing: From $89/month, includes WhatsApp conversation fees
- Integrations: Shopify, Klaviyo, Gorgias, Loyoly, Zendesk, Splio
- Support: Dedicated onboarding, live chat, 24/7 documentation
Pros: E-commerce focused, fast ROI, AI-powered automation, no technical setup required
Cons: Best suited for Shopify (other platforms coming soon)
2. Twilio

Best for: Developers building custom solutions
Twilio is a communications infrastructure platform. The WhatsApp API is one of many channels they offer. Great if you have developers who want full control.
- Setup time: Days to weeks (requires development)
- Key features: Programmable messaging, multi-channel, custom workflows
- Pricing: Pay-per-message ($0.005/message + Meta fees), no platform fee
- Integrations: Via API (requires custom development)
- Support: Documentation-heavy, paid support plans
Pros: Maximum flexibility, established infrastructure, multi-channel
Cons: Requires developers, no e-commerce features out of the box, complex pricing
3. MessageBird (Bird)

Best for: Enterprise multi-channel communication
Bird (formerly MessageBird) offers an omnichannel platform combining WhatsApp, SMS, email, and more. Strong in enterprise and customer service use cases.
- Setup time: 1-2 weeks
- Key features: Omnichannel inbox, flow builder, customer data platform
- Pricing: Custom pricing (typically $500+/month for meaningful usage)
- Integrations: Shopify, Salesforce, HubSpot
- Support: Dedicated account manager (enterprise)
Pros: Omnichannel, strong enterprise features, global reach
Cons: Expensive for SMBs, complex setup, overkill for pure WhatsApp marketing
4. Gupshup

Best for: High-volume messaging in emerging markets
Gupshup is strong in India and Southeast Asia. They process billions of messages monthly and offer competitive pricing for high-volume senders.
- Setup time: 1-3 days
- Key features: Bot platform, conversation automation, rich messaging
- Pricing: Pay-per-message (competitive rates in emerging markets)
- Integrations: API-first (limited native integrations)
- Support: Regional support teams
Pros: Cost-effective at scale, strong in APAC, good bot platform
Cons: Limited European presence, fewer e-commerce integrations
5. 360dialog

Best for: Agencies and resellers
360dialog focuses on providing WhatsApp API access at the lowest possible cost. They're popular with agencies and developers who want direct API access without platform fees.
- Setup time: Hours (API-only)
- Key features: Direct API access, number management, template management
- Pricing: From €5/month per number + Meta fees only
- Integrations: Via API
- Support: Community and documentation
Pros: Cheapest option, direct API access, transparent pricing
Cons: No UI tools, requires development, no marketing features
6. Infobip

Best for: Large enterprises with complex communication needs
Infobip is a global cloud communications platform with deep carrier relationships and regulatory expertise across 190+ countries.
- Setup time: 1-2 weeks
- Key features: Omnichannel, CPaaS, customer engagement hub
- Pricing: Custom (enterprise-level)
- Integrations: Salesforce, Adobe, SAP, Microsoft Dynamics
- Support: 24/7 global support, dedicated teams
Pros: Global infrastructure, enterprise-grade, multi-channel
Cons: Enterprise pricing, complex for small businesses
Feature Comparison Table

| Feature | Kanal | Twilio | Bird | Gupshup | 360dialog | Infobip |
|---|---|---|---|---|---|---|
| Abandoned Cart Recovery | ✅ Built-in | ❌ Custom dev | ⚠️ Limited | ❌ Custom dev | ❌ No | ⚠️ Limited |
| AI Chatbot | ✅ Included | ❌ Custom dev | ⚠️ Basic | ✅ Bot platform | ❌ No | ⚠️ Basic |
| Shopify Integration | ✅ Native | ⚠️ Custom | ⚠️ Plugin | ❌ No | ❌ No | ❌ No |
| No-Code Setup | ✅ Yes | ❌ No | ⚠️ Partial | ⚠️ Partial | ❌ No | ⚠️ Partial |
| Broadcast Campaigns | ✅ Visual builder | ❌ Custom dev | ✅ Yes | ✅ Yes | ❌ API only | ✅ Yes |
| Starting Price | $89/mo | Pay-per-use | $500+/mo | Pay-per-use | €5/mo | Custom |
Migration Timing and Risks per Provider
Switching providers is a real operation, not a click. Here's what to expect for each.
From Kanal to another provider
- Time to migrate: 1 to 2 days. Number porting takes 4 to 24 hours via Meta.
- Templates: have to be re-submitted to Meta and re-approved by the new platform.
- Customer history: kept by Meta on the WhatsApp Business Account, not lost during port.
- Risk level: Low. Kanal exports your contact list and template library on request.
From Twilio to another provider
- Time to migrate: 3 to 7 days, depending on custom code dependencies.
- Templates: held in Twilio's content API. Need to be exported and re-submitted.
- Webhooks: every webhook URL pointing to your old Twilio integration needs updating.
- Risk level: Medium-High. Custom code on top of Twilio often has hidden dependencies.
From 360dialog to another provider
- Time to migrate: 2 to 3 days.
- Templates: stored in your WhatsApp Business Account, transferable.
- Pricing model differs: 360dialog charges flat hosting plus per-conversation Meta cost. Plan for the new provider's billing differences.
- Risk level: Medium. Mostly affects developer-built integrations.
From Bird (MessageBird) to another provider
- Time to migrate: 5 to 10 days, given enterprise contract complexity.
- Multi-channel impact: if you're using Bird for SMS + email + WhatsApp, you'll need to migrate each separately or accept partial migration.
- Risk level: High for enterprise setups. Plan for legal review of contract terms.
From Wati or Charles to another provider
- Time to migrate: 2 to 4 days.
- Wati and Charles are similar to Kanal in that they bundle the WhatsApp API with a UI. Migration is mostly about porting the number and re-importing contacts.
- Risk level: Low to Medium.
Common pitfalls during any migration
- Forgetting to re-submit templates: campaigns silently fail until templates are approved.
- Incorrect webhook URLs: incoming messages get lost.
- Quality rating reset: a fresh number on a new provider may start at Tier 1, capping your sending volume for the first weeks.
- Customer expectations: tell your customers nothing changes (they don't need to do anything), but expect a few minutes of downtime during number porting.
Kanal's onboarding includes a managed migration: we handle template re-approval, webhook setup, contact import, and quality rating monitoring during the first 2 weeks post-port.
How to Choose the Right Provider
Choose Kanal if you're a Shopify store wanting to maximize revenue with WhatsApp marketing, without needing developers. You'll get abandoned cart recovery, AI chatbot, and broadcast campaigns working within minutes.
Choose Twilio if you have a development team and want to build a custom solution with full control over the messaging infrastructure.
Choose 360dialog if you're a developer or agency wanting the cheapest possible API access with no platform overhead.
Choose Bird or Infobip if you're an enterprise needing omnichannel communication across multiple countries and channels.
Getting Started
Ready to choose a provider? Here's what to do next:
- Define your use case: are you focused on marketing, support, or transactional messages?
- Estimate your volume: monthly conversations determine your costs
- Check integrations: make sure the provider connects with your existing tools
- Start a trial: most providers offer free trials or demos
For e-commerce brands on Shopify, we recommend starting with Kanal's free trial. You can be up and running in under 10 minutes.
Understanding WhatsApp API Pricing
Regardless of which provider you choose, you'll pay Meta's conversation-based pricing. Learn more in our WhatsApp Business API pricing guide.
The key thing to understand: Meta charges per 24-hour conversation window, not per message. This makes WhatsApp significantly more cost-effective than SMS for ongoing customer engagement.
Nicolas helps e-commerce brands grow revenue with WhatsApp marketing. With deep expertise in Shopify ecosystems and conversational commerce, he shares proven strategies for abandoned cart recovery, broadcast campaigns, and AI-powered customer engagement.
Ready to boost your WhatsApp sales?
Suggested articles

WhatsApp Business API Guide: Setup, Pricing, BSPs (2026)
WhatsApp Business API explained: how it works, pricing per conversation, top BSPs, Shopify integration, and a step-by-step setup checklist for e-commerce.

WhatsApp Chatbot for E-Commerce: Automate 80% of Support (2026)
WhatsApp AI chatbot guide for Shopify stores in 2026. Automate 80% of customer support, recover carts, and answer pre-purchase questions 24/7. Setup, examples, ROI.

WhatsApp Automated Messages: 12 Ready-to-Use Templates (2026)
12 WhatsApp automated message templates for Shopify stores in 2026. Welcome, away, post-purchase, recovery flows. Setup guide for the API and the Business app.

RCS Messaging: The Complete Guide for E-commerce (2026)
RCS (Rich Communication Services) explained for Shopify in 2026. RCS vs SMS vs WhatsApp, carrier rollout status, pricing, and where it fits in your messaging stack.